Yoshiyuki Sakuraba is a scholar working on Molecular Biology, Immunology and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Yoshiyuki Sakuraba has authored 32 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 10 papers in Immunology and 7 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Yoshiyuki Sakuraba’s work include Reproductive System and Pregnancy (9 papers), DNA Repair Mechanisms (7 papers) and Reproductive tract infections research (6 papers). Yoshiyuki Sakuraba is often cited by papers focused on Reproductive System and Pregnancy (9 papers), DNA Repair Mechanisms (7 papers) and Reproductive tract infections research (6 papers). Yoshiyuki Sakuraba collaborates with scholars based in Japan, United States and Canada. Yoshiyuki Sakuraba's co-authors include Yoko Nagai, T. Hashimoto, Koichi Kyono, Yoichi Gondo, Hirokazu Inoue, Toshihiko Shiroishi, Hideki Kaneda, Satoshi Tateishi, Masaru Yamaizumi and John Roder and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Neuron.
